Anthony Shadid, 1968-2012

Anthony Shadid has died. A brilliant, insightful reporter, whose work illuminated so much of the complexity of the Middle East — and who, at times, was subject to it, as during his capture and imprisonment with three other journalists during the Libyan revolution — he will be much missed, and our understanding will be poorer for his passing.

For those interested in the politics of the region, Shadid gave a moving lecture at the American University of Beirut several years ago, a talk entitled “Loss and Nostalgia in the Middle East.” It’s available for view on the AUB website. Well worth watching.
